PagerDuty reported second-quarter fiscal 2026 earnings per share (EPS) of $0.32, significantly exceeding the consensus estimate of $0.2552 by 25.39%. Despite the pronounced earnings beat, shares declined by 3.29% in after-hours trading, potentially reflecting market disappointment on factors beyond core profitability. Revenue details were not disclosed in this preliminary release.
